In recent months, Google has placed greater importance on its Weather app. For instance, in December 2023, the company launched a stand-alone Google Weather app, enabling Google Clock app connectivity on Pixel phones. Before this, Google Weather was just a widget because the weather data and its main features were taken straight from the Google app.
Google also upgraded its sources for weather information earlier in 2023. Notably, the company began utilizing data from the MRMS and HRRR sensor systems operated by the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ration. To provide more precise forecasts, the information from current data sources was to be integrated with it. Nowcast is a weather model that enables the updated Weather app and widget’s real-time predictions of impending rain, snow, and hail.
